Specialty Items in Richmond Hill

A piano is not heavy furniture. It is a strung frame under tens of thousands of pounds of tension, mounted in a case that was never designed to be carried, and the difference decides how it gets moved. The weights set the crew. An upright runs 300 to 500 pounds, a baby grand 500 to 600, and a full grand anywhere from 600 to 1,200. Uprights go onto a padded piano board on their back edge and travel strapped upright. Grands come apart first: the legs, the lid, and the pedal lyre are removed before the body is lowered onto the board, because the legs are joinery, not structure, and a grand carried on them is a grand being broken slowly. Everything then rides under quilted blankets, and staircases are handled with stair-climber dollies rather than muscle. Richmond Hill produces more of these jobs than most of the GTA. Oak Ridges and Bayview Hill formal living rooms sit at the top of curved or split-level staircases more often than not, and a curved staircase changes the geometry of the carry, not just its difficulty. Those are among the more involved piano moves we run anywhere in the region. The same crews handle the rest of the specialty range that these homes generate: antique furniture passed down through generations, fine art and wine collections, and the hot tubs, pool tables, and gun safes that fill finished basements. Antiques and art are wrapped in acid-free materials, and where wrapping is not enough, wooden crates are built to measure. The heavy items are rigged, partially disassembled where required, and moved with equipment built for the weight. Our depot sits roughly 28 kilometres from Richmond Hill, and we deliberately schedule specialty work with extra planning time to confirm access, staircase dimensions, and doorway clearances before the crew and equipment leave, so nothing is discovered on the day. Enhanced valuation coverage that reflects true replacement value is offered on every specialty quote rather than kept as a rarely-used add-on, because the items coming out of Richmond Hill's estate homes are disproportionately likely to exceed basic limits. Every crew member is WSIB covered and background checked.

What We Do

How Our Specialty Items Works in Richmond Hill

Specialty service in Richmond Hill covers piano moving, antique and fine art transport, hot tub and pool table relocation, gun safe moving, and custom crating for anything standard materials cannot protect. Piano moves start at a three-mover minimum, because the weight needs proper spotters on stairs and through doorways rather than two people and optimism. Grands, and any piano involving the staircases and tight turns common in Oak Ridges and Bayview Hill homes, often move to a four-mover crew with additional equipment. After the move, a piano needs to settle. We recommend waiting two to three weeks before booking a tuning so the instrument acclimates to the humidity and temperature of its new room — an instrument tuned the day it arrives will drift as soon as it equalizes. That advice comes standard with every piano booking, whether the destination is across town or across the country. Antiques and fine art are wrapped in acid-free materials, with custom wooden crates built for marble tabletops, oversized mirrors, sculpture, and anything blankets and boxes cannot adequately protect. Richmond Hill's estate and heritage village homes use this far more than a typical condo move does. Hot tubs and pool tables are partially disassembled where required, moved on hydraulic lifts or dollies, then reassembled and re-levelled at the destination. Gun safes up to 2,000 pounds are moved through tight basement stairwells and hallways with equipment built for exactly that. Every specialty item is assessed for weight, dimensions, and access before move day, and enhanced valuation coverage is available for anything you want protected above our standard coverage.

Local Expertise

We Know Richmond Hill Inside Out

Richmond Hill's larger, older housing stock in Oak Ridges and Bayview Hill produces more specialty item requests than we see in denser, newer areas of the GTA. Formal living rooms with grand pianos, finished basements with hot tubs and pool tables, and multi-generational homes with inherited antique furniture are common across these two neighbourhoods in particular. Downtown Richmond Hill's heritage village, centred near Yonge Street and Major Mackenzie Drive, has some of the oldest housing stock in the town, and the antique and collectible furniture we move from these homes often needs custom crating rather than standard blankets and boxes, given the age and condition of the pieces. Jefferson and the newer subdivisions tend to have fewer inherited antiques but more modern specialty items like large sectional sofas, home theatre equipment, and gym equipment that still require careful handling and, in some cases, partial disassembly. Access is the recurring challenge across Richmond Hill specialty moves. Oak Ridges properties with long driveways and elevation changes between the street and the front door require careful planning for heavy items like pianos and safes, and we assess this during the pre-move walkthrough so the right equipment, dollies, ramps, or a stair climber, is on the truck before the crew arrives. Bayview Hill and downtown Richmond Hill properties, with their proximity to Highway 404 and Highway 407 ETR, also see more cross-GTA specialty transfers, moving a piano or antique piece between a Richmond Hill home and a family member's property elsewhere in the region. We treat these transfers with the same care and equipment as a full specialty move, regardless of the shorter distance involved.

Transparent Pricing

Specialty Items Rates in Richmond Hill

Specialty item moves in Richmond Hill are billed hourly with a crew size matched to the item. Piano moves and other heavy specialty items carry a three-mover minimum; larger or more complex items may need four movers. 3 Movers: $219–$315 per hour 4 Movers: $279–$387 per hour The flat truck fee for Richmond Hill is $249. An upright piano move typically runs two to three hours with a three-mover crew, putting the all-in cost between $687 and $906 off-peak or $879 and $1,194 at peak-season rates, truck fee included. A grand piano move involving a staircase, or a comparable hot tub or safe extraction, typically runs three to five hours with a four-mover crew, putting the all-in cost between $1,086 and $1,644 off-peak or $1,410 and $2,184 at peak-season rates, truck fee included. Custom crating is quoted separately based on the item's dimensions and the materials required. We provide a firm estimate after reviewing your specific item and access conditions.
